Transaction 57f8a870c3b28d2d82c63515d6d9cf67b3c958cd7f55e5019c9da10eaf60ef11
1 Input
1 Output
-
57f8a870c3b28d2d82c63515d6d9cf67b3c958cd7f55e5019c9da10eaf60ef11:0
- value
- 5434134
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7abc4e3da571ce96603c025043f198d05e45240a OP_EQUAL
- address
- 3CsywejqW7kdaE1X3nkeLLoG2zk6FDgxoM